We’re looking for a Receptionist to join our Primary Care Team based at our prestigious private GP Clinic in Manchester. As a Receptionist, you’ll be the welcoming face of the company. You will be required to provide a warm, friendly and knowledgeable service at all times, as well as being immaculately presented in front‑of‑house uniform. You will be expected to provide an efficient patient experience from start to finish. Above all else, we’re committed to the care and improvement of human life. This guiding vision influences everything we do at HCA UK. From the CEO to the colleagues on the floor, we all have a part to play in delivering exceptional care to our patients.
What you’ll do:
- Meet and greet all patients, visitors, GPs and staff and assist with their enquiries.
- Have a good understanding of the medical system and the relevant Microsoft Office programmes.
- Issue clients with the necessary paperwork and explain forms.
- Deal with face‑to‑face, telephone and e‑mail queries with an excellent telephone manner and communication skills.
- Work collaboratively with the Registered Manager and Clinical staff to deliver the patient journey.
- Be visible, accessible and approachable for staff, patients and the public and ensure effective communication and resolution of any on‑site enquiries or escalation of complaints to the Senior Receptionist.
In this role, you will learn from our leading experts and will contribute to the vital care of our patients as a valued member of the HCA Group.
What you’ll bring:
- Previous knowledge and experience in the hospitality service or healthcare industry would be advantageous.
- Good general level of education to GCSE level or equivalent: 5 GCSEs or more preferred at C grade or above.
- Excellent spoken and written English.
- Computer literate with proven experience of Microsoft Office and information systems.

How to prepare for a job interview at HCA Healthcare
✨Know Your Role
Before the interview, make sure you understand what being a Receptionist at a private GP clinic entails. Familiarise yourself with the responsibilities listed in the job description, such as greeting patients and handling enquiries. This will help you demonstrate your knowledge and enthusiasm for the role.
✨Showcase Your Communication Skills
As a Receptionist, excellent communication is key. Practice articulating your thoughts clearly and confidently. You might even want to prepare examples of how you've successfully handled customer queries or complaints in the past, as this will show your ability to maintain a friendly and professional demeanour.
✨Dress to Impress
Since you'll be the welcoming face of the clinic, it's important to present yourself immaculately. Choose an outfit that reflects the professional environment of a healthcare setting. This not only shows respect for the role but also helps create a positive first impression.
✨Prepare Questions
Interviews are a two-way street, so come prepared with thoughtful questions about the team, the clinic's culture, and how they support their staff. This shows your genuine interest in the position and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
